The Core Logic: What a Fair Value Gap Actually Represents
The Three-Candle Definition
A Fair Value Gap forms across three consecutive candles. In a bullish FVG, the high of the first candle and the low of the third candle don't overlap — there's a visible price void between them, created by the second candle's aggressive, uninterrupted move upward. In a bearish FVG, the inverse: the low of the first candle sits above the high of the third, with the second candle driving price down through the space with no opposing pressure.
The critical detail is why the gap forms. It isn't a technical quirk of candlestick math — it's evidence that the move happened too fast for the opposite side of the market to provide adequate liquidity. Buyers or sellers weren't just outnumbered; they were effectively absent at those price levels during the move.
Why the Market Returns to Fill It
Markets price inefficiently in the short term and correct toward efficiency over time. A Fair Value Gap is, by definition, an inefficient stretch of price — a zone where trading barely occurred. This creates two separate forces pulling price back toward it:
- Unfilled resting orders. Participants who wanted to transact at those levels during the initial move often couldn't, because the price moved through too quickly. Their orders remain resting at those levels, waiting.
- Algorithmic fair-value referencing. A range with almost no completed trading doesn't represent an accepted, agreed-upon price. Institutional execution algorithms tracking volume-weighted fair value treat these zones as reference points the market is statistically likely to revisit before continuing.
This is the mechanical basis for "rebalancing" — the market isn't reversing out of some abstract sense of fairness, it's responding to real unfilled orders and algorithmic reference behavior that both point back toward the same price zone.
Why It Doesn't Always Fill Completely — And Why That Matters
This is the detail most retail explanations skip. Price frequently reacts before fully filling the gap, often at its midpoint — a level referred to as the Consequent Encroachment (CE). The CE represents the 50% mark of the gap, and it's a high-probability reaction zone in its own right, not just a waypoint on the way to a full fill.
Waiting for a full fill assumes every gap behaves identically, which they don't. A gap formed with strong displacement and no accompanying order block nearby often gets fully filled. A gap formed alongside a fresh order block — where the two zones overlap — frequently reacts at the CE or even before it, because the combined zone represents a denser concentration of unfilled interest than the FVG alone.
Fresh vs. Mitigated Gaps
A Fair Value Gap that price has not yet returned to is "fresh" — the unfilled orders behind it are, in principle, still fully resting. A gap that price has already touched once and reacted to is "mitigated" — some or all of the original imbalance has already been addressed, and a second reaction at the same zone carries meaningfully less weight than the first. Frequently Asked Questions
Why does price always seem to come back and fill the fair value gap?
Because the gap represents genuinely unfilled orders left behind by a fast, one-sided move, along with a reference point institutional algorithms track as an area of incomplete price discovery. The return isn't random — it's the market addressing unfinished business at that level.
Should I wait for the gap to fill completely before trading it?
Not necessarily. Many reactions occur at the Consequent Encroachment — the 50% midpoint — rather than at the full boundary of the gap, especially when the gap overlaps with a nearby order block. Waiting for a full fill on every setup means missing a large share of valid reactions.
What's the difference between a Fair Value Gap and a general price imbalance?
Every Fair Value Gap is a type of imbalance, but not every imbalance is a Fair Value Gap. An FVG has a specific structure — a three-candle pattern where the outer wicks don't overlap — while "imbalance" is a broader term that can describe other forms of price inefficiency without that exact structural requirement.
